  • Liam Holds Weak Script Together

    I've refused Prime's outrageous $20 rental for new releases since they started. But tonight - only for Liam Neeson- I paid up. Liam does a great acting job, but the script and direction were pitiful. Jumping from scene to scene as if nine writers each did a chapter and never collaborated. It barely ties together. Last 30 minutes of film, at height of action, Liam captures bad guy boss after street fight, gives him an ultimatum, then, snap! Film jumps to happy ending. Thought maybe I'd dozed off and missed several scenes! But even rewinding to repeat last 1/4 of film didn't help. Waste of money and time. Only positive was Liam Neeson.
